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
735 238 660608474 898 77
65 2319856
65 2319856
12719188645 1003 91850694509 18
All about undefined
Interested in learning more?
65 2319856
12719188645 1003 91850694509 18
See more
569153 0496
12788 8387033 244 1955796702
See more
3068 901258297 070
85824701932 49 728145
See more